There are companies out there that think that since so many people surf and shop online that they don't need any brand recognition. That simply does not make sense to me. Do you know the names of any online stores or businesses? Ever heard of Amazon or Ticketmaster? If you need it for an offline business it is important for an online one too.
Whether you have a cute little storefront or a super flashy web based dynamo on the internet, people will be much more likely to do business with you if they know your name. If you have been working on getting your name out, you are on the right page. This is the sort of thing that you really can't rest on until you have some success. It is that important.
What every business needs is something to be recognized for. A symbol, a saying, some sort of image. You need a logo. You have to go with something and don't change it for anything. Once people get used to seeing that you don't want to change out to something else because you will lose them. If you don't hand feed the general public something very simply they will lose all memory and interest so quickly it will make your head spin.
You need to have someone see you logo or hear your jingle several times before they will become interested or curious. This is only the beginning of the advertising process. Once people begin to feel familiar with your logo, you will have to convince them of your seniority over similar businesses, but that comes later. No one will even get to that point without name recognition first.
